识别来自欺骗URL重定向的流量 - PHP/Apache
问题描述:
在我脑海中几天后就一直在这里转动。这是情况。识别来自欺骗URL重定向的流量 - PHP/Apache
几个星期前,一个人买了一个类似的域名,并将其设置为301重定向到我的实际页面。然后,他使用它来编写软件开发人员,向他们的应用程序请求按键,以便在我们的出版物中查看有用的空间
我想要的是当有人登录我的网站时从特定的URL重定向中显示一条特殊消息。
因此,如果用户A在进入网站:example.org和被重定向到example.com自动网站提供不同的网页用户B.
用户B直接进入网站:example.com
通过这种方式,我可以向开发者提示他们已被钓鱼,并忽略他们收到的电子邮件,并将其转发给我的真实地址,以便我可以将其添加到受影响公司的执法人员名单中。
系统是一个LAMP环境
在此先感谢!
答
你看什么是$_SERVER['HTTP_REFERER']
,它适用于大多数的浏览器。所以,你需要做的是
if ($_SERVER['HTTP_REFERER'] === 'put-referral-url-here.com')
{
//redirect to page b
header('Location: http://www.example.com/pageb.html');
}
参考的Server Variable文档和this
进一步阅读